Zion-Benton Township High School reports 21% truancy rate
The truancy rate at Zion-Benton Township High School fell to 21 percent during the 2019-20 school year, according to a Lake County Gazette analysis of the latest Illinois schools report card.

Zion-Benton Township High School scores 22.8% ELA proficiency, 15.1% on math in 2019
Of the 2,207 students attending Zion-Benton Township High School in 2019, 22.8 percent scored proficient in English Language Arts and 15.1 percent were proficient in math, according to a report recently released by the Illinois State Board of Education (ISBE).

Report: 63 percent of 2018 Zion-Benton Township High School graduates in Illinois community colleges had to take remedial classes
In the two years after 82 percent of Zion-Benton Township High School's class of 2018 graduated on time, 63 percent of those who attended Illinois community colleges had to enroll in remedial courses.
